The Job Responsibilities
We are looking for a Sr Test Engineer to work onsite in our Andover, MA location.
The Senior Test Engineer is responsible for evaluation, development, implementation, maintenance and improvement of manufacturing test systems/tools/equipment, including design documentation. Key responsibilities also include developing test strategies and technologies, and interfacing with diverse groups within Draeger and with external suppliers.
Responsibilities:
- Evaluate, develop, implement, maintain and improve manufacturing test systems, tools, & equipment, including custom test hardware and software, and all related design documentation.
- Create and maintain test equipment design documentation and test / calibration / preventive maintenance instructions; conduct related technical training for Production personnel.
- Write and execute verification & validation protocols for test equipment per FDA requirements.
- Support the introduction of new products concerning test concepts and test development; work within project teams to define test equipment development project plans and deliverables & estimate work effort.
- Participate in detailed design reviews and code inspections in accordance with SOPs.
- Perform investigations of test failures and during special projects, including low-yield analysis; implement solutions for improving test solutions.
- Support development of new work processes, automated tools and test capabilities in manufacturing for improving quality & efficiency.
- Identify continuous improvement opportunities; develop and implement solutions.
- Performs other duties as needed and assigned.
